Case booked after 13-year-old boy drowns at water storage point in Forest Academy
A 13-year-old boy drowned after slipping into a water storage point at Keerthivanam inside the Forest Academy on Sunday evening. The Petbasheerbad police booked a case.
The deceased has been identified as Nagesh, a Class V student of Shantinikethan School in Jeedimetla and a resident of Dulapally.
According to the officials, the boy had visited the place along with two friends from his village when the incident occurred.
Police said the boys were playing near a water storage structure when Nagesh accidentally slipped and fell in. Locals rushed to the spot and, with the help of emergency services, shifted him to a private hospital, where doctors declared him brought dead.
A case has been registered and further investigation is underway to ascertain the circumstances leading to the incident.
